Bartender

Hunters Run Country ClubBoynton Beach, FL

About The Position

The Bartender is responsible for all beverage services for the Club.  He/she will be passionate about providing excellent customer service to each member and guest by performing the following duties:

Responsibilities

  • Greet members upon arrival and address them by name whenever possible. Take their drink order within two minutes of their arrival.
  • Prepares and serves alcoholic beverages according to the Club’s recipes.
  • Interacts and converses with the members in a pleasant, courteous, and professional manner.
  • Always attends the bar.
  • Know when to slow and refuse alcoholic beverage service when necessary.
  • Inspect the bar prior to opening to ensure there are adequate supplies and all necessary equipment.
  • Stocks and set up the bar by following the Club’s procedures.
  • Prepares a daily beverage requisition according to the Club’s procedures.
  • Reviews reservations and meets with the Captain or Manager on Duty regarding the day’s events.
  • Attends daily training and service meetings as required by the Captain or Manager on Duty.
  • Prepare garnishes, fruit mixes and any pre-mixed drinks prior to opening.
  • Maintains and cleans all soda guns, bar areas, bar storage areas, coolers, and equipment.
  • Washes and restocks all provided glassware.
  • Ensures proper set up and break down of the bar. Secures all alcohol in locked cabinets at the end of each shift. Cleans, properly stores all supplies, garnishes, etc. and completes other pre-closing requirements for all bars and other areas as assigned by following the Club’s procedures.
  • Checks out at the end of each shift with the Captain or Manager on Duty.
  • Ensures all proper setup, inventory, any needed record keeping, and breakdown of banquet events is handled according to the BEO.
  • Suggests wine and beverage pairings to members and guests to enhance their dining experience.
  • Knows all food and beverage menus. Handles all food service for members dining at the bar by following proper steps of service and by inputting orders into a point-of-sale system.
  • Answer the telephone within three rings.
  • Assists with monthly beverage inventories.
  • Notifies the Manager on Duty of any inefficiencies or malfunction of equipment.
  • All other tasks assigned by the supervisor or manager.
